ВУЗ: Не указан
Категория: Не указан
Дисциплина: Не указана
Добавлен: 01.06.2024
Просмотров: 14
Скачиваний: 0
Лабораторна робота № 3
Тема: «Символьні обчислення в MATLAB».
Мета роботи: знайомство з основними положеннями пакету символьних обчислень
Symbolic Matli Toolbox; робота з символьними змінними, матрицями,
математичними виразами; освоєння символьних аналітичних обчислень - спрощення
виразів. вирішення рівнянь алгебри, вирішення системи лінійних рівнянь,
обчислення суми ряду; освоєння символьної інтеграції і символьного
диференціювання; отримання практичних навиків роботи в діалоговому режимі.
Хід роботи
Завдання № 1
Вирішити рівняння алгебри, використовуючи команду solve:
Завдання № 2
Вирішити систему рівнянь алгебри, використовуючи команду solve. Вибратирівняння згідно своєму варіанту з табл.
Завдання № 3
Спростити вирази, використовуючи команду simplify:
Завдання № 4
Обчислити суму ряду, використовуючи команду symsum. Вибрати рівняння згідно своєму варіанту з табл.
Завдання № 5
Обчислити похідну функції по х, використовуючи команду diff. Вибрати
функцію згідно своєму варіанту з табл.
Завдання 6
Використовуючи функцію int підготувати і організувати обчислення певного
інтеграла: Підінтегральна функція f(х) визначена і безперервна на інтервалі а <= х <= b. Вид підінтегральної функції f(х), а також інтервал інтеграції [а b] визначається номером варіанту з табл.
Конрольні запитання.
-
Перерахуєте пакети розширення MATLAB.
Partial Differential Equation Toolbox (пакет для вирішення диференціальних рівнянь
в приватних похідних, залежних від двох змінних):
- Statistic Toolbox (вирішення завдань статистики):
- Femlab Toolbox (вирішення тривимірних рівнянь математичної фізики):
- Image Processing Toolbox (вирішення завдань обробки зображень);
- Fuzzy Logic Toolbox (вирішення завдань методами нечіткої логіки):
- Wavelet Toolbox (вирішення завдань обробки сигналів і зображень методом
вэйвлет-претворень);
- Simulink (пакет для моделювання динамічних систем) та ін.;
- Symbolic Math Toolbox призначений для виконання символьних обчислень;
- Пакет Symbolic Math Toolbox розроблений фірмою Waterloo Maple Software.
-
Як отримати довідку по командах пакету.
- Для отримання довідки по командах пакету Symbolic Math Toolbox (рис.1) слід
відкрити відповідний розділ Help, або отримати допомогу по команді:
-
Яка функція використовується для створення символьних змінних і служить для звернення до стандартних функцій?
Для створення символьних змінних використовується функція sym, у якої наступний
синтаксис:
ім'я змінної = sym(' ім'я змінної’)
-
Яка команда використовується для вирішення рівнянь алгебри?
Для вирішення системи рівнянь алгебри використовується команда solve
-
Яка команда використовується для спрощення виразів алгебри?
Для спрощення виразів використовується команда simplify.
-
Яка команда використовується для обчислення сум рядів?
Для вирішення рівнянь алгебри використовується команда symsum.
-
Що необхідно зробити для обчислення похідної функції?
Для обчислення похідної функції f ( х ) необхідно:
- задати вираз, що описує функцію;
- звернутися до функції diff.
-
Перерахуєте функції, службовці для обчислення інтегралів в символьному
вигляді.
Дня обчислення інтегралів в символьному вигляді використовується функція int.